Collision Risk Alert
This function warns the driver if there is a risk
of collision with the preceding vehicle or with a
pedestrian.
Modifying the alert trigger threshold
This trigger threshold determines the sensitivity
with which the function warns of the risk of
collision.
The threshold is set via the
Driving/Vehicle touch screen menu.
Select one of the three pre-dened
thresholds: "Far", "Normal" or "Close".
The last threshold selected is memorised when
the ignition is switched o󰀨.
Operation
Depending on the collision risk detected by the
system and the alert trigger threshold chosen
by the driver, di󰀨erent levels of alert may be
triggered and displayed on the instrument panel.
The system takes into account the vehicle
dynamics, the di󰀨erence speed of the own
vehicle and the object identied for the
collision risk, and the operation of the vehicle
(e.g. actions on the pedals, steering wheel) to
trigger the alert at the most relevant moment.
(orange)
Level 1: visual alert only, warning that the
preceding vehicle is very close.
The message "Vehicle close" is displayed.
(red)
Level 2: visual and audible alert, warning
that a collision is imminent.
The message "Brake!" is displayed.
While approaching a vehicle too quickly,
the level 2 alert may be displayed
directly.
Important: the level 1 alert depends on the
trigger threshold selected. It reacts only on
moving vehicles. It is disabled automatically
at lower speed.
It is possible that collision warnings are
not given, are given too late or seem
unjustied.
The driver must always stay in control of the
vehicle and be prepared to react at any time
to avoid an accident.
Intelligent emergency
braking assistance (iEBA)
This function increases vehicle deceleration
if the driver does not brake enough to avoid a
collision.
This assistance is only provided if the driver
presses the brake pedal.
